프로그래밍-학습기록/코딩테스트
백준 온라인 저지 | 3052 | 배열: 나머지
leesche
2020. 7. 28. 14:29
문제
나의 풀이
쉬웠다. '정렬'을 해야 independentNumberCount를 정확하게 감소시킬 수 있었다.
package baekjunOnlineJudge;
import java.util.Scanner;
import java.util.Arrays;
public class Bj_3052 {
public static void main(String[] args) {
Scanner sc = new Scanner(System.in);
int remainderList[] = new int[10];
int independentNumberCount = 10;
for(int i=0; i<10; i++) {
remainderList[i] = sc.nextInt() % 42;
}
Arrays.sort(remainderList);
for(int i=0; i<9; i++) {
if(remainderList[i]==remainderList[i+1]) {
independentNumberCount--;
}
}
System.out.println(independentNumberCount);
}
}